The vice president of the Drug Distribution Companies Association says drug fluctuations are just a number for officials.

Mahalati, vice president of the Drug Distribution Companies Association

Vahid Mahalati states that drug fluctuations might just be a few numbers, but from the patient’s perspective, it means numerous problems and significant discomfort.

It is the duty of all members of the drug supply chain to act in a way that does not create trouble and problems for patients.

Some drugs cannot be changed, and even the manufacturer of drugs like Warfarin cannot be changed because it can cause complications for the patient.

Therefore, talking about drug fluctuations is simple, but it creates serious problems for patients.

In the import sector, shortages or surpluses of drugs also create problems.

Sometimes there is a shortage of drugs, and with the sudden influx of liquidity, all factories rush to production, resulting in a surplus of drugs, which can cause more problems than a shortage.
